Built for home-service businesses

The AI front office for plumbing businesses

Burst pipes at midnight, water heaters that fail on Saturday morning, customers who want someone there in an hour. Corvyn is designed to help answer inbound, capture urgency, and route to your team in real time.

Currently onboarding select home-service teams.

πŸ“ž
Voice AI for inbound calls
A voice agent designed to answer when your team can't, capture job details, and route to a person when needed.
πŸ“₯
Every source, one inbox
Supported channels, phone, web forms, chat, and provider leads, can flow into the same inbox with source attached.
πŸ“…
Scheduling that syncs
Appointment booking, confirmations, and reminders designed to work with calendars your team already uses, in supported integrations.
βœ…
Follow-up and reviews
Follow-up sequences and review requests that can be configured for timing, consent, and channel per your settings.
Scenarios

How Corvyn is designed to handle the work for Plumbing

Operational scenarios the system is built for.

Emergency calls outside business hours

The voice agent is designed to answer, capture the address and the nature of the emergency, and route to on-call technicians based on rules you configure.

Residential and commercial routing

Commercial and residential plumbing calls can require different response playbooks. Corvyn can capture segment at intake and tag the lead so it reaches the right team based on your configuration.

Drain service recurring reminders

Recurring service customers can be enrolled in scheduled reminders, with consent and opt-out settings respected according to your configuration.

Water heater replacement leads

Inbound for larger-ticket work like water heater replacement can be tagged at intake and routed to the estimator pipeline rather than dispatch, based on categories you configure.

Channel mix

Lead channels that matter for Plumbing

Supported channels are designed to flow into the same inbox with source preserved.

Google LSA
A primary paid channel for plumbing
Google Ads
High intent for emergency and repair
Angi
Marketplace leads
Facebook
Community referrals
Phone
Direct and repeat customers
FAQ

Common questions from Plumbing owners

Will the AI handle emergency calls at 2am?
Yes. The voice agent is designed to answer inbound at any hour, capture the nature of the emergency and the address, and route to on-call techs based on rules you set.
Can it tell the difference between a commercial and residential job?
The agent can be configured to ask segment at intake and tag leads accordingly. Routing rules by segment are yours to set in the team configuration.
What about calls where the customer is unclear on the issue?
When the agent cannot reliably capture the nature of the issue, the call can be routed to your team with the transcript and a flagged task so a person can follow up.
How does Corvyn handle repeat service customers?
Known customers can be matched against the contact record at call time where records exist, and relevant context can be surfaced to the agent based on your configuration. That context can then be captured in the call record for your team.
Can I review and approve outbound messages before they send?
Yes. You can configure sequences to require approval, or let the system send automatically within the communication rules and quiet-hour settings you configure.
Does Corvyn support Spanish-speaking customers?
The voice agent can support multi-language conversations in supported setups. Configuration for your specific language mix is handled during onboarding.

See how Corvyn fits other trades

See if Corvyn fits how your business runs

We're onboarding select home-service teams in a structured pilot. If the front-office workload is the bottleneck, we'd like to learn how your business handles it today.